All three ways of spelling the word, with accents or without, are considered correct: resume, résumé and resumé. Of these three, the third (resumé) is considered the least acceptable, as it follows neither French nor English conventions.

plural résumés or résumes Britannica Dictionary definition of RÉSUMÉ [count] 1 US a : a short document describing your education, work history, etc., that you give an employer when you are applying for a job If you would like to be considered for the job, please submit your résumé. — called also (chiefly British) curriculum vitae

résumé (rezjʊmeɪ , US -zʊm- ) also resumé Word forms: plural résumés 1. countable noun A résumé is a short account, either spoken or written, of something that has happened or that someone has said or written. I will leave with you a resumé of his most recent speech. We began each planning meeting with a résumé of how we were doing as a division.

Resume Accents or Not—. It is correct to spell resume with accents ( résumé) or without accent marks ( resume ). The most common form ignores the dashes. Incorrect forms include: résume, resumè, resume'. The form resumé is accepted by some sources, but is inconsistent with standard spelling rules.


Regular & Irregular Plural Nouns How to Make Plurals in English? ESL

A résumé (with the accent marks) is "a brief written account of personal, educational, and professional qualifications and experience, as that prepared by an applicant for a job." It's pronounced [ rez - oo -mey ] as opposed to how resume is pronounced [ ri- zoom ].
